问题标签 [alasql]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
json - 使用 alasql 获取所有数组属性数据
我这里有一个具有数据数组的 JSON 对象。我的问题是如何获取数组数据以将其导出到 excel?我目前正在为此使用 alaSql。
javascript - 在 AlaSQL/JS-XLSX Excel 导出上定义单元格格式
是否可以在 AlaSQL 导出到 Excel 时定义单元格格式?
我正在维护一个使用 AlaSQL 将网格数据导出到 Excel 的系统。问题是 Excel 数据没有被转换为 NUMBER。DATE 值可以,但数字类型始终显示为常规。通过在 JS 中强制转换为 Number 类型,xls 文件中会显示消息“Number stored as Text”。
我认为直接使用 js-xlsx 解决这个问题会更容易,但它会在项目中产生很多变化,这不是一个选择。
我需要使用类似于此处显示的jsFiddle的东西,将 json 选项传递给 alasql 函数。
下面,一个简单的代码作为示例:
感谢您的关注。
sqlite - alasql 附加到 sqlite
TANACH_6_1.db 与以下 HTML 位于同一位置。它运行(没有错误),但终端上没有出现任何内容。检查并重新检查语法并查看了几个示例。在“SQLEXPERT”中测试了 sql。alasql 正在工作,因为我能够创建一个内存数据库。请帮忙:
alasql - ALASQL:如何引用它自己的 JSON 对象(在其上调用函数)?
我有以下对象,我想称它为函数。
现在我知道对象是否可以嵌套([{a:1, b:{fn:function(){} } }]
),b->fn()
但是当它是第一个元素的直接属性时,我该怎么做呢?
我试过了,SELECT fn() FROM ...
但这给出了Uncaught SyntaxError: Unexpected token ,
(所以不是正确的解析器错误)。
alasql - AlaSQL:获取操作数的位置
我有一个具体的要求,我很确定这不是微不足道的,但为了以防万一,我想问一下。如果我有任何WHERE
条件查询:
WHERE
在这种情况下,我想知道参与的所有操作数['a', 'b', 'a->fn(b->c)', 0]
。
原因是我想跟踪这些值,如果有任何变化,我就会重新评估查询。
json - 简单 node.js 应用程序中的高 RAM 使用率
我制作了这个简单的 node.js 应用程序:
如您所见,我加载了 database.json 文件,对其进行了一些 alasql 查询并将该数据作为响应返回。database.json 的大小约为 50MB。我的问题是这个应用程序使用了 400-600MB 的 RAM!
我也制作了这个版本,我使用 .require 打开 database.json 文件,但是内存消耗是一样的!
我做错了什么,我想这是关于我的 JSON 文件大小的一些问题?它是 55000 条记录的数组,每条记录有 20 个字段,如果该信息对您有帮助吗?
jquery - xlsx.core.min.js:13 未捕获的错误:不支持的文件 NaN
我在使用带有 xlsx.core.js 的 alasql 时遇到错误。代码是
出现的错误是。=> 未捕获的错误:不支持的文件 NaN 我该如何解决此错误。或建议我可以从中访问 excel 文件中数据的任何其他文件。
图书馆是:
一件重要的事情,这段代码在昨晚完全运行,当我今天运行它时,它给出了这个错误。
谢谢。别介意..我英语很差。和新的堆栈溢出。
javascript - 查询 JavaScript 对象组
我有一个这样的 JavaScript 对象:
我想将此对象字段'a'分组并想要这样的东西:
我有一个包含数千个元素的 JavaScript 数组。实现这一目标的最有效方法是什么?